Fix datumSerialize infrastructure to not crash on non-varlena data.
Commit 1efc7e5 did a poor job of emulating existing logic for touching Datums that might be expanded-object pointers. It didn't check for typlen being -1 first, which meant it could crash on fixed-length pass-by-ref values, and probably on cstring values as well. It also didn't use DatumGetPointer before VARATT_IS_EXTERNAL_EXPANDED, which while currently harmless is not according to documentation nor prevailing style. I also think the lack of any explanation as to why datumSerialize makes these particular nonobvious choices is pretty awful, so fix that. Per report from Jarred Ward. Back-patch to 9.6 where this code came in. Discussion: https://postgr.es/m/6F61E6D2-2F5E-4794-9479-A429BE1CEA4B@simple.com

* Serialize a possibly-NULL datum into caller-provided storage.
284284
*
285+
* Note: "expanded" objects are flattened so as to produce a self-contained
286+
* representation, but other sorts of toast pointers are transferred as-is.
287+
* This is because the intended use of this function is to pass the value
288+
* to another process within the same database server. The other process
289+
* could not access an "expanded" object within this process's memory, but
290+
* we assume it can dereference the same TOAST pointers this one can.
291+
*
285292
* The format is as follows: first, we write a 4-byte header word, which
286293
* is either the length of a pass-by-reference datum, -1 for a
287294
* pass-by-value datum, or -2 for a NULL. If the value is NULL, nothing
